Everything You Should Know Before Moving to Linden Beach, SD
Thinking about relocating to Linden Beach, SD? With a cozy population of 2,450, Linden Beach offers affordable living, with median home prices around $226,000 and two-bedroom rents averaging $820. Residents enjoy short commutes (about 14 minutes), low tax rates, and excellent access to nature and sunny days (61% annually). Crime rates are low, schools are well-rated, and the town boasts a welcoming, close-knit community feel—ideal for those seeking a peaceful lakeside lifestyle in South Dakota.

Cost Of Living
What is the average cost of living in Linden Beach, SD?
The cost of living in Linden Beach is notably affordable, with a median home value of $226,000 and a two-bedroom rent averaging $820. Residents benefit from very low state taxes and living expenses that are well below the national average, making it an attractive option for budget-conscious households.

Crime
Is Linden Beach, SD a safe place to live?
Linden Beach enjoys a low crime rate, with only 210 violent crimes and 1,420 property crimes per 100,000 residents. The chance of experiencing a violent crime is about 1 in 476, providing a generally safe environment for families and individuals alike.

Weather
What is the weather like in Linden Beach, SD year-round?
The climate in Linden Beach features chilly winters with lows around 7°F and warm summers reaching up to 83°F. With 61% of days being sunny and annual rainfall totaling 22.5 inches, the area offers a pleasant mix for those who enjoy all four seasons.

Housing Market
What is the housing market like in Linden Beach, SD?
The housing market in Linden Beach is stable, with a median home price of $226,000 and 70.3% of homes owner-occupied. Rental vacancies are moderate, and home values have appreciated by 3.6% over the past year, reflecting steady demand.
